About Nahargarh Biological Park:

Nahargarh Biological Park, situated on the outskirts of Jaipur, encompasses an extensive area of lush greenery and scenic beauty. Established with the aim of conserving and protecting the region’s diverse wildlife, the park serves as a safe haven for numerous species. The park’s natural habitats are carefully designed to mimic the animals’ native environments, ensuring their well-being and providing visitors with a unique opportunity to observe them in their natural habitats.

Things To Do in Nahargarh Biological Park:

Wildlife Safari: Embark on an exhilarating wildlife safari and traverse the park’s well-laid trails. Accompanied by experienced guides, visitors can explore the park in specially designed safari vehicles, spotting animals such as lions, tigers, leopards, and various species of deer. The safari offers an unforgettable experience of witnessing these majestic creatures up close and observing their natural behavior.

Bird Watching: Nahargarh Biological Park is a paradise for bird enthusiasts. With its diverse range of avian species, including peacocks, parakeets, eagles, and more, the park provides ample opportunities for birdwatching. Visitors can witness these beautiful creatures in their natural habitat, capturing breathtaking moments and immersing themselves in the symphony of nature.

Nature Trails and Picnics: For those seeking a leisurely experience amidst nature, the park offers well-marked nature trails that wind through its picturesque landscapes. Visitors can embark on a refreshing walk, taking in the sights, sounds, and scents of the park’s flora and fauna. Additionally, designated picnic areas provide the perfect setting for a relaxed outing with family and friends, surrounded by the beauty of nature.

Timings:

Nahargarh Biological Park is open to visitors from 9 am–5 pm. The park is easily accessible by road, with ample parking facilities available for convenience. Visitors can choose to explore the park at their own pace or join organized tours led by knowledgeable guides who provide valuable insights into the park’s wildlife and conservation efforts.

The Majestic Wildlife of Nahargarh Biological Park:

Nahargarh Biological Park is home to a diverse range of wildlife species. From the regal lions and tigers to the agile leopards and graceful deer, the park offers a glimpse into the captivating world of these magnificent creatures. Visitors can spot various species of deer, including the spotted deer, sambar deer, and chital, roaming freely in their natural habitat.

The park’s big cat enclosures house lions and tigers, allowing visitors to observe these powerful predators from a safe distance. The sight of these majestic creatures prowling through their enclosures is a testament to the park’s commitment to conservation and wildlife welfare.

Additionally, Nahargarh Biological Park supports the conservation of various bird species. The park’s diverse ecosystems attract a multitude of avian visitors, making it a paradise for birdwatching enthusiasts. From the resplendent peacocks displaying their vibrant plumage to the melodious calls of parakeets and the soaring flights of eagles, the park offers a captivating experience for bird lovers.
